January 5, 2007 - United States Attorney Patrick L. Meehan today announced the filing of a one-count indictment* charging CHARLES LENDEN FRENCH, a Jamaican national also known as “Christopher Henry,” with unlawful re-entry into the United States after deportation, in violation of Title 8, United States Code, Section 1326. The indictment alleges that on December 8, 2006, FRENCH was found in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ania after having been twice previously deported from the United States in 2001 and 2004.
This indictment arose out of an investigation conducted by U.S.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E). Defendant FRENCH faces a maximum sentence of 10 years imprisonment, three years supervised release, a $250,000 fine and a $100 special assessment.
